nRF52480 dongle as a central device, and Debugging and programming issues using segger j-link

Hello,

I am trying to program my nrf52840 dongle to act as a BLE central device and I am using the  USB CDC ACM Module. I am facing the following issues:

1- I was able to program it to serve one peripheral, but I am not able to do it for several peripherals.

2- I cannot program or debug my dongle using the segger j-link tool, as the dongle keeps flashing red after everything seems to be successful.

    2- I cannot program or debug my dongle using the segger j-link tool, as the dongle keeps flashing red after everything seems to be successful.

     The nRF52840 Dongle does unfortunately not have a Segger chip on it, so it is impossible to debug without an external debugger.

    Have you looked at the nRF52840 Dongle Programming Tutorial? It is a great place to start with Dongle programming!
